Websol Energy System has commenced optimum production from August to operationalise 280 MW of cell and 250 MW of module line capacity. For August, the company has secured sufficient orders which are under execution and is in negotiations for securing further orders, it said in a notice to the stock exchanges. The company has started securing and negotiating long-term contracts to operationalise its full capacity under the implementation of safeguard duty on Cell and Modules by the Government of India on July 31, 2018. The company hopes to sustain long-term contracts with solar EPC contractors and integrators in the domestic market and from various other geographies. Shares of Websol Energy closed at ₹48.65, a gain of 3.73 per cent, on the BSE.
